选择合适的游戏引擎对于新手开发者和经验丰富的团队来说都是至关重要的。随着技术的不断进步和市场需求的变化,游戏引擎的种类和功能也日益丰富。了解这些不同的引擎将帮助开发者做出明智的决定,提高游戏开发的效率和质量。

行业内最为流行的游戏引擎包括Unity、Unreal Engine和Godot等。Unity以其用户友好的界面和丰富的社区支持而受到广泛欢迎,适合2D和3D游戏开发。Unreal Engine则因其强大的图形处理能力和实时渲染功能,成为大型游戏制作的首选,引擎的蓝图系统则让非程序员也能轻松上手。Godot作为一种轻量级开源引擎,不仅灵活而且功能强大,非常适合独立开发者和小型团队。
在选择游戏引擎时,开发者应该考虑多个因素,例如目标平台、预算、团队规模和开发经验。想要开发移动游戏的团队,可能会倾向于使用Unity,而计划制作高保真PC或主机游戏的团队则可能选择Unreal Engine。市场趋势表明,越来越多的开发者也开始关注开源引擎,Godot便是一个理想的选择。
硬件环境也是决定引擎选择的重要因素。现代游戏开发需要较高的计算和图形处理能力,合适的显卡和处理器能够显著提升工作流程的流畅度。最新的硬件评测表明,搭载RTX系列显卡的机器在处理3D图形时表现出色,尤其适合使用Unreal Engine进行开发。优化系统性能,也是确保游戏运行流畅的关键一步。
而对于DIY组装电脑的爱好者来说,选择合适的硬件组件也是极为重要的一环。根据自身需求选择合适的主板、显卡和内存,能够在很大程度上提升开发和运行游戏的效率。与此合理的散热和电源管理也是不容忽视的因素,避免因过热导致性能下降或硬件损坏。
对游戏引擎的选择无疑是影响开发成功与否的关键因素之一。希望每位开发者在选择时都能够深入了解各个引擎的特点,以便为自己的项目找到最适合的工具。
常见问题解答:
1. 什么是游戏引擎?
游戏引擎是用于开发和创建视频游戏的软件框架,提供了图形渲染、物理模拟、声音处理等功能。
2. Unity和Unreal Engine有什么区别?
Unity更适合2D游戏和移动平台,而Unreal Engine则在图形性能和复杂3D场景下表现更优。
3. Godot引擎适合哪个类型的开发者?
Godot是一个开源引擎,非常适合独立开发者和小型团队,提供灵活的编程语言支持。
4. 我如何判断我的硬件是否适合游戏开发?
检查处理器性能、显卡类型和内存容量,大型3D游戏开发推荐使用高性能硬件。
5. 游戏引擎的选择对游戏性能有多大影响?
良好的引擎可以帮助开发者更高效地利用硬件资源,从而提升游戏的运行性能和整体体验。
